Alternative English Proficiency Tests and Certifications

Okay, so IELTS might not be your thing. No problem! There are other ways to show universities you’re fluent in English. TOEFL, Duolingo English Test, and PTE Academic are all solid options. Sometimes, universities will even accept your English grades from 12th grade, or a letter from your old school confirming classes were taught in English. This letter is often called a Medium of Instruction (MOI) certificate, and it can be a lifesaver!

Test/CertificationDescription
TOEFL iBTThis is a pretty well-known English test. It checks how well you read, listen, speak, and write. [ETS TOEFL].
Duolingo English TestThis one’s online and tests the same skills as TOEFL – reading, writing, listening, and speaking. Plus, it’s super convenient.
PTE AcademicThis is another computer-based English test that lots of universities around the world accept. [Pearson PTE].
Medium of Instruction (MOI) CertificateBasically, it’s a letter from your old school saying that your classes were taught in English. Easy peasy!

Top Universities in Belgium Accepting Students without IELTS

Okay, so which universities in Belgium will let you in without an IELTS score? Turns out, quite a few! They’re usually happy to consider other ways to prove you’re good at English.

Think TOEFL, DET, or that Medium of Instruction certificate we just talked about. Here’s a quick rundown:

University NameAlternative English RequirementPopular Programs
Ghent UniversityTOEFL iBT, Duolingo English Test, or MOI Certificate.Engineering, Biotechnology, and Social Sciences.
KU LeuvenTOEFL iBT, PTE Academic, CAE/CPE, or MOI Certificate.Engineering, Computer Science, and Business.
Vrije Universiteit Brussel (VUB)TOEFL iBT, Duolingo English Test, CAE/CPE, or MOI Certificate.Law, Communication Studies, and Political Science.

Application Process for Universities in Belgium without IELTS

Alright, let’s talk about applying. The process is pretty straightforward. First, find universities and check what English language proof they accept. Then, get all your documents ready, fill out the online application, and practice for any interviews they might throw your way. Don’t forget to research scholarship opportunities too, like those mentioned in How to Study in Belgium with Scholarships: A Complete Guide for International Students.

  1. Research Universities: Find universities that offer the course you want and see what their admission rules are.
  2. Review Language Requirements: Double-check which IELTS alternatives they’ll accept, like TOEFL, DET, or MOI.
  3. Prepare Necessary Documents: Collect your transcripts, recommendation letters, and write a killer statement of purpose.
  4. Submit Applications: Fill out and send in those online application forms with everything they need.
  5. Attend Interviews (if required): Some universities might want to chat with you online to see how good your English really is.
  6. Receive Admission Decision: Now, just wait and see if you get in!

Important Documents Required for Admission without IELTS

Getting your documents in order is super important. They’re proof of your awesomeness! Make sure everything’s translated correctly and officially certified if needed. You’ll likely need similar documents if you choose to explore Masters Courses in Belgium.

Document NamePurpose
Academic TranscriptsThese are your official school records, showing all your grades and qualifications.
Statement of Purpose (SOP)This is where you get to tell your story – what you want to study and why.
Letters of Recommendation (LORs)These are letters from teachers or employers who can vouch for you.
English Proficiency ProofThis is how you show you’re good at English – TOEFL, DET, or that MOI certificate.
Passport CopyA copy of your passport to prove who you are.
